A previоusly heаlthy schооl-аge child develops а cough and a low-grade fever. The Family Nurse Practitioner auscultates wheezes in all lung fields. Which diagnosis will the nurse practitioner suspect? Correct answer: atypical pneumonia Wheezing in a child over 5 years of age without a history of wheezing may point to an atypical pneumonia. Bacterial pneumonia is characterized by diminished breath sounds or crackles along with high fever. Bronchiolitis causes coarse wheezing. Bronchitis is characterized by cough without adventitious lung sounds.
